Revenue has compounded at 0.9% per year over the past 19 years to 23.20 M EUR. Earnings per share have declined at 9.3% per year over the last 17 years. Trilogiq's net margin stands at 4.6%, up from -1.4% several years earlier. Trilogiq currently offers a dividend yield of about 9.62%. The payout ratio is around 34% of earnings. Analysts set a median price target of 6.12 EUR, implying 17.7% above the current price. Of 9 analysts, 8 rate the stock a buy — an overall Buy consensus. The stock trades about 13% above its 52-week low.

Income Statement Key Figures

Revenue and Revenue Growth

Revenue is the starting point of every income statement — it measures the total sales Trilogiq generates from its core business. Revenue growth (expressed as year-over-year percentage change) is one of the most important indicators of business momentum. Sustained growth above 10 % annually is generally considered strong, while declining revenue is a serious warning sign that demands investigation.

Gross Margin

Gross margin = (Revenue − Cost of Goods Sold) ÷ Revenue. It reveals what percentage of each dollar of revenue Trilogiq retains after direct production costs. High gross margins (above 50 %) are typical of asset-light businesses like software and brands, while capital-intensive industries like manufacturing often operate below 30 %. Compare Trilogiq's gross margin to industry peers and track it over time to spot improving or deteriorating pricing power.

EBIT and EBIT Margin

EBIT measures operating profit — what remains after subtracting all operating expenses (including R&D, sales, and administrative costs) from gross profit. The EBIT margin shows this as a percentage of revenue. Because it excludes interest and taxes, EBIT allows fair comparisons between companies with different debt levels and tax jurisdictions. A rising EBIT margin indicates improving operational efficiency.

Net Income and Earnings Per Share (EPS)

Net income is the company's final profit after all expenses, interest, and taxes. Dividing net income by the number of shares outstanding gives you EPS — the single most influential metric in stock valuation. Consistent EPS growth is the primary driver of long-term stock price appreciation. Always check whether EPS growth comes from genuine profit improvement or from share buybacks reducing the share count.

Shares Outstanding

The total number of shares Trilogiq has issued. A declining share count (through buybacks) boosts EPS and signals management confidence. A rising share count (through stock issuance) dilutes existing shareholders. Always monitor this number alongside EPS to get the full picture of per-share value creation.

Trilogiq business model & stock analysis

The company Trilogiq SA was founded in France in 1992 and has since become a world-leading company in the field of modular manufacturing and logistics. The business model of Trilogiq is based on the idea that effective manufacturing and logistics depend on the right combination of components. Therefore, the company offers a variety of modular solutions that can be individually customized to the customer's needs. One of Trilogiq's main business areas is the manufacturing of modular workstations. These systems are designed to increase efficiency and productivity in manufacturing while creating ergonomic working conditions. The workstations include a variety of components, including work surfaces, shelves, drawers, tool holders, and more. They can be customized in different ways to meet the customer's needs. Another core business of Trilogiq is logistics. The company provides a wide range of logistic solutions that optimize material flow in manufacturing and storage. This includes modular transport carts, shelving systems, and other solutions that facilitate the transportation and storage of goods. Trilogiq is also active in the field of equipping warehouses and production facilities. The company offers solutions for a variety of industries, including automotive, food and beverage, electronics, and many more. Products include shelves, containers, and other storage solutions. Another important division of Trilogiq is lean management. The company offers training and consulting services to support customers in implementing lean manufacturing principles. The goal is to increase productivity, reduce costs, and improve quality. Trilogiq has a long track record of success and can look back on numerous satisfied customers. The product range of Trilogiq includes a huge range of components that can be combined to create customized solutions. These include aluminum pipes, joints, connectors, plastic components, and more. These components are easy to assemble and can be quickly and easily adapted to changing requirements. What Is Fair Value?

Fair value is an estimate of what a stock is truly "worth" based on its financial fundamentals, independent of the current market price. If the calculated fair value is above the current share price, the stock may be undervalued — and vice versa. This chart shows three different fair value approaches so you can cross-check them against each other.

Earnings-Based Fair Value

Calculated by multiplying the current earnings per share (EPS) by the average historical P/E ratio over a selected multi-year period. The smoothing over several years filters out temporary spikes or dips. If this fair value exceeds the market price, it suggests the stock is cheap relative to its earning power.

Example: Fair Value (Earnings) 2022 = EPS 2022 × Average P/E 2019–2021

Revenue-Based Fair Value

Derived by multiplying revenue per share by the average historical price-to-sales ratio. This method is particularly useful for companies with volatile or temporarily depressed earnings, as revenue tends to be more stable than profits. It answers: "At what price has the market historically valued each dollar of this company's sales?"

Example: Fair Value (Revenue) 2022 = Revenue per Share 2022 × Average P/S 2019–2021

Dividend-Based Fair Value

Calculated by dividing the dividend per share by the average historical dividend yield. This approach is most relevant for mature, consistently dividend-paying companies. If the resulting fair value is higher than the current price, it implies the stock offers a better yield than its historical average.

Example: Fair Value (Dividend) 2022 = Dividend per Share 2022 ÷ Average Yield 2019–2021

How to Use This Chart

When all three fair value lines converge above the current price, it strengthens the case that the stock is undervalued. When they diverge, investigate why — it may indicate a structural shift in margins, payout policy, or growth rate. The forward estimates on the right extend the analysis using projected fundamentals, helping you assess whether the current price already reflects future growth expectations.

Trilogiq SA is a globally leading company in the field of material handling and logistics solutions. The company offers a wide range of products and services specifically tailored to customer needs, with a focus on optimizing manufacturing processes and reducing waste to increase efficiency and competitiveness. Trilogiq SA's core competencies lie in planning, designing, and implementing logistics solutions for intralogistics and production. The company has five different product categories, including assembly carts and transport solutions, lean production platforms, Industry 4.0 solutions, dynamic warehousing, and office furniture. Trilogiq SA also provides services such as consulting, design, and training. The company operates globally in industries such as automotive, manufacturing, and logistics.
